Shirley M. (Rice) Morawski

March 13, 1925 ~ March 5, 2017 (age 91) 91 Years Old

 Montague- Shirley M. (Rice) Morawski, 91, of Montague, formerly of Greenfield, died peacefully at home with loved ones, on Sunday 3/5/17.  She was born on March 13, 1925 in Keene, NH, the daughter of Arthur R. and Edna (Pitchford) Rice.  Shirley attended local schools in Keene before moving to Greenfield in 1940 with her family.  She graduated from Greenfield High School in 1943 and continued her education at Cooley Dickinson Hospital School of Nursing, becoming a Registered Nurse upon graduation in 1946. 

Shirley worked for several years as a Registered Nurse at Franklin County Public Hospital, Vermont Yankee and as a private duty nurse. She was secretary and co-owner with her husband, Red, of Mohawk Office Equipment Company, retiring in 1987.

Shirley was an honorary life member of the Greenfield Emblem Club, where she served as President for four years locally and as a state officer for six years. She was an active member of the First Baptist Church in Greenfield for over sixty years where she served as a deaconess.  Following dissolution of the First Baptist Church she was a member of the First Congregational Church in Montague until her passing.

Shirley and Red enjoyed dancing together at The Elks and Moose Lodges, and took Disco dance lessons in the 70’s. In years past, she kept busy with golf in the summer and bowling in the winter. She enjoyed watching her children’s and grandchildren’s sporting events, knitting, reading and charity work. In her later years she enjoyed taking pottery classes with her daughter, Pam. She was also a big fan of the Patriots, Red Sox and Celtics.
